The Crisis in Ghana’s Schools Across Ghana, thousands of schools especially in rural and under-served areas lack basic ‘Water, Sanitation, and Hygiene (WASH)’ infrastructure. Children attend schools without clean drinking water, without toilets, without handwashing facilities. The consequences are devastating:
  • Girls miss school during menstruation due to lack of private, dignified sanitation facilities
  • Children fall sick from poor hygiene, leading to absenteeism and poor academic performance
  • Teachers struggle to maintain healthy learning environments
  • Open defecation around school compounds exposes children to diseases
  • WASH4School exists to change this.

What We Do

WASH4School is dedicated to creating safe, healthy learning environments by improving ‘Water, Sanitation, and Hygiene (WASH)’ infrastructure in rural and under-served schools. Under this program, we:
  • Build and rehabilitate water points so pupils and teachers have reliable access to clean water on school grounds. No child should be thirsty while learning.
  • Provide gender-sensitive sanitation facilities, including separate and dignified toilets for girls and boys. Privacy and dignity matter, especially for adolescent girls.
  • Promote hygiene education, teaching handwashing, menstrual hygiene management, and safe water practices. Knowledge empowers lifelong healthy behaviors.

Methodology

Our WASH4School Approach

01

School Assessment

We work with school administrators, Parent-Teacher Associations (PTAs), and District Education Offices to assess WASH needs and prioritize schools with the greatest need.

02

Infrastructure Development

We construct or rehabilitate vital facilities:

  • Water points: Boreholes with taps and rainwater harvesting systems
  • Toilet blocks: Separate facilities for girls (including menstrual hygiene management provisions) and boys
  • Handwashing stations: Fitted with soap dispensers
03

Hygiene Education

We train teachers and students on essential practices:

  • Proper handwashing techniques (critical for preventing disease)
  • Menstrual hygiene management for girls
  • Safe water handling and storage
  • Environmental sanitation around school compounds
04

Community Engagement

We involve PTAs and community members in maintaining school WASH facilities, ensuring long-term sustainability beyond our intervention.

Target Locations

Priority Schools

WASH4School directs resources where intervention is needed most, targeting schools in:

Northern, Upper East & Upper West

Regions where WASH infrastructure gaps are most severe.

Eastern & Volta Regions

Remote and rural schools operating with no existing facilities.

Underdeveloped Schools

High-need basic and rural schools nationwide requiring intervention.
